Zalewski","doi":"10.2478/jok-2022-0004","DOIUrl":"https://doi.org/10.2478/jok-2022-0004","url":null,"abstract":"Abstract In this paper a simulation of a vehicle’s braking maneuver in various adopted road conditions has been presented. The aim of this paper was to answer the question whether the random irregularities of a road surface could limit the distance covered by the braking vehicle. At the same time it seems necessary to consider the damaging effect of the road irregularities along with the lack of comfort for both the driver and the passengers. The adopted maneuver of braking started at the initial speed of 100 km/h each time and lasted 10 s. The irregularities adopted for the simulation had three different amplitudes which enabled analysis of vehicle’s deceleration on variously uneven road. Almost different profiles were assumed for the left and the right wheels of the vehicle’s model as well as both the dry and the icy surface on the road.","PeriodicalId":342247,"journal":{"name":"Journal of KONBiN","volume":"21 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"2022-03-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"123600695","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Tokarski, Krzysztof Obłąkowski, Janusz Parucki, Tomasz Kucharzewski, Tadeusz Kwiatkowski","doi":"10.2478/jok-2022-0007","DOIUrl":"https://doi.org/10.2478/jok-2022-0007","url":null,"abstract":"Abstract This manuscript describes the proprietary method of diagnosing one-way clutches of Mi-24 at their earlier wearing stage, which is challenging to diagnose with traditional methods (vibroacoustic). The FAM-C method is based on the analysis of frequency modulation of the on-board generator driven from the examined power unit. It enables to observe the influence of other mechanical elements on the operation of this clutch: it monitors all rotary subassemblies of aircraft connected with mechanical power transmission. The manuscript aims to review the typical defects of one-way clutches in helicopter propulsion systems, describe the FAM-C method as a basic method at the early diagnosing stage and confirm its efficiency based on the provided results.","PeriodicalId":342247,"journal":{"name":"Journal of KONBiN","volume":"6 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"2022-03-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"114167882","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
